อาการ
หลังจากที่คุณติดตั้งการปรับปรุงความปลอดภัย Exchange Server กุมภาพันธ์ 2023 ใน Microsoft Exchange Server 2019 หรือ 2016 พูลโปรแกรมประยุกต์เว็บ Exchange Web Services (EWS) หยุดการตอบสนองภายใต้บางสถานการณ์ เมื่อเกิดเหตุการณ์นี้ขึ้น ไคลเอ็นต์ที่ใช้ปัญหาการเชื่อมต่อประสบการณ์ใช้งานโพรโทคอล EWS
นอกจากนี้ รหัสเหตุการณ์ 4999 ต่อไปนี้จะได้รับการบันทึกไว้ในบันทึกของแอปพลิเคชัน:
E12IIS, c-RTL-AMD64, 15.01.2507.021, w3wp#MSExchangeServicesAppPool, M.Exchange.Diagnostics, M.E.D.ChainedSerializationBinder.EnforceBlockReason, M.E.Diagnostics.BlockedDeserializeTypeException, 437c-dumptidset, 15.01.2507.021.
การแก้ไขปัญหา
ปัญหานี้ได้รับการแก้ไขแล้วในการอัปเดตความปลอดภัยสําหรับ Exchange Server ประจําเดือนมีนาคม 2023 ปฏิบัติตามขั้นตอนต่อไปนี้:
-
ถ้าคุณใช้วิธีแก้ไขปัญหาชั่วคราวที่ให้ไว้ก่อนหน้านี้ในบทความนี้ ให้ทําตามขั้นตอนเหล่านี้เพื่อแปลงกลับการเปลี่ยนแปลง:
-
เอาค่ารีจิสทรีต่อไปนี้ออก:คีย์ย่อย: ค่าHK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\ExchangeServer\v15\Diagnostics: DisableBaseTypeCheckForDeserializationType: ข้อมูลสตริง: 1 หรือ ให้เรียกใช้คําสั่งต่อไปนี้เพื่อลบค่ารีจิสทรี: Remove-ItemProperty -Path HKLM:\SOFTWARE\Microsoft\ExchangeServer\v15\Diagnostics -Name "DisableBaseTypeCheckForDeserialization"
-
ลบการตั้งค่าแทนที่โดยการเรียกใช้คําสั่งต่อไปนี้:
Get-SettingOverride | Where-Object {$_. ComponentName -eq "Data" -and $_. SectionName -eq "DeserializationBinderSettings" -และ $_. Parameters -eq "LearningLocations=ClientExtensionCollectionFormatter"} | Remove-SettingOverride
-
รีเฟรชอาร์กิวเมนต์ VariantConfiguration โดยการเรียกใช้คําสั่งต่อไปนี้: Get-ExchangeDiagnosticInfo -Process Microsoft.Exchange.Directory.TopologyService -Component VariantConfiguration -Argument Refresh Note คําสั่งนี้จะไม่จําเป็น การตั้งค่านี้ควรมีประสิทธิภาพโดยอัตโนมัติภายในหนึ่งชั่วโมง
-
เมื่อต้องการนําการตั้งค่าใหม่ไปใช้ ให้เริ่มการทํางานของ World Wide Web Publishing Service และบริการการเปิดใช้งานกระบวนการของ Windows (WAS) ใหม่ เมื่อต้องการทําเช่นนี้ ให้เรียกใช้คําสั่งต่อไปนี้: Restart-Service -Name W3SVC, WAS -Force Note คําสั่งนี้จะมีหรือไม่ก็ได้ บริการควรเริ่มระบบใหม่โดยอัตโนมัติภายในหนึ่งชั่วโมง
-